Some have a small hole, some have a jiggle valve in the hole, others just 
have a small nick in the seal between the moving and fixed parts, see 
http://www.mgb-stuff.org.uk/thermostat.htm#4.  Less to do with bypass than 
air-lock bleeding, the bypass port is in the head below the thermostat, so 
the pump can circulate coolant through the block and head to prevent 
hot-spots while the system is warming up.
